The very first thing a person does when they want to join the siteworld is create their name. Most people have "lyts" in their name, but that was mostly in myspace days when people actually used layouts. (Layouts = the backgrounds you would put on your profile) You have to be creative with it and hope no one else has that name yet. Once you have your name, you create your account on facebook and get to making signs.
Signs - A designed picture, which can be three different types.
First, you have to find a few sitemodels. A sitemodel is just someone who models for you. Each sitemodel will most likely have a manager. A manager is someone who makes sure their model stays off rare sites (explained later), their model is not faked, and they watermark and hand out the pictures.
The first photo is one without a watermark, obviously. The second one has her name and friend ID. This is so the picture can't be stolen. Usually the watermark is faded a bit, but the one below I didn't fade at all because of the pictures quality.
Because her friend ID is 100002414574307, I wrote that below her name in the watermark.
Every time a manager water marks a picture, they will upload it onto the sitemodels account. They are making this picture available for request.
The sites that would like to use this picture in their sign will comment "Can i have this one?" and the manager will give it out to the sites that requested it.
Before you're able to request the picture though, you have to sign a sitemodel note. For an example, look below.
Okay, so now we've gotten our request picture. What now? Most people use photoshop when they edit. You have to decide whether you're making a simple sign, preppy/showtime style sign, or a vexel.
This is a preppy sign, also called "showtime style":
See how behind my sitemodel theres lines? For a better look at the "background" look below.
This is called a sun vector which has been shortened to vector. All of the designs on the colors are called brushes and patterns
When making a preppy sign, the most important thing you will need is called scanlines Because you use them to stroke on almost everything.

Simple sign:
As you can see, there is no vector in it. Theres just a bunch of colors and brushes. If you don't understand what a brush is, its basically an image that adds effect to the picture. See the drip thing? Thats a brush. Theres also hearts and other things you can add.
A vexel is a cartooned image.

When you've finished your sign, you must add your site name so your sign cannot be stolen. There are some sites who take another talented site and use their site name and pretend everything they do, is theirs.
